Transaction 29396c904190cf129c077a7c11046518f8d1a423cd9b2c47e1d0dae55e16fde0

1 Input
2 Outputs
  • 29396c904190cf129c077a7c11046518f8d1a423cd9b2c47e1d0dae55e16fde0:0
  • value  55000000
    address  2MukcqrkEB5brNd8yq4Zvbi1Hc1nKmwPdaB
  • 29396c904190cf129c077a7c11046518f8d1a423cd9b2c47e1d0dae55e16fde0:1
  • value  3488003507
    address  2Mwha5xC1ZUi1Kvm3Za4cciwyTu6Vzek74k